sunxi: video: When using edid use CEA681 extension blocks to select hdmi output
When using edid use CEA681 edid extension blocks to select between dvi and hdmi output formats, so that u-boot will automatically do the right thing. Signed-off-by: Hans de Goede <hdegoede@redhat.com> Acked-by: Ian Campbell <ijc@hellion.org.uk> Acked-by: Anatolij Gustschin <agust@denx.de>
